Where We Are Now is three nights of original spoken word by young and diverse performers, each night centring on a different theme: Body, Mind and Earth respectively. Examining gender, body image, mental illness and the pressing issue of climate change, this show is about the world right now through the eyes of a generation that is now coming of age.

Featuring a host of talented, dynamic and diverse performers, Where We Are Now provides insight into universal human wonderings and the complications of living in the 21st century. The performers ask and offer their own answers to the question: what does it mean to be alive right now?

Where We Are Now is created and produced by teen writers and performers Bridie Noonan and Zadie McCracken. This series of performances at the Melbourne Fringe Festival will be its world premiere.
